Brindlewood Bay is a tabletop roleplaying game that combines Murder, She Wrote with H.P. Lovecraft. In it, you play a group of elderly women, members of the local Murder Mavens Mystery Book Club, who help the authorities solve murder cases in a picturesque New England Town. Trophy Dark is a roleplaying game about a group of treasure-hunters entering a haunted forest that doesn’t want them there.
